Detailed introduction to the route and destinations
This loop covers three iconic attractions in the core Kanas scenic area of northern Xinjiang. The summer operating period for Kanas Scenic Area in 2026 is from May 1 to October 15. The entire route focuses on natural landscapes and suits various travel needs including family trips, friend gatherings, and parent-child outings.
Kanas Scenic Area:As the core stop of the loop, the maximum daily capacity in summer 2026 is 27,000 visitors, with entry and exit hours from 08:00-20:00. The scenic area’s sightseeing buses and village shuttle services operate until 24:00. Core attractions include three lake bays — Xian Bay, Moon Bay, and Wolong Bay — as well as walking trails along the Kanas Lake shore. In summer, spruce and fir trees grow densely along the lakeside, and the lake color shifts through different shades of blue-green with changing light. The scenic area also features a visitor service center, medical emergency stations, and dining facilities, making it a well-developed tourist destination.

The village is distributed along the Hemu River, with wooden houses scattered across the valley. In the early morning, advection fog often blankets the village, creating a stunning view. The village features walking trails, viewing platforms, local dining options, and specialty cultural shops, perfect for a slow-paced visit.
Baihaba Village:Maximum daily capacity in summer 2026 is 8,000 visitors. Located in a mountain valley surrounded by grasslands and forests, the village offers a relaxed pace, ideal for travelers seeking a quiet atmosphere.
All three scenic areas implement a real-name reservation and ticket purchase system. You can book tickets in advance before your trip to avoid arriving without tickets and being unable to enter. When daily capacity approaches its threshold, crowd management measures will be activated. The veteran driver will also flexibly adjust the visiting order based on daily crowd alerts to maximize your comfort.

Arrive at Colorful Beach (Wucaitan) in the afternoon for a visit — at sunset, the rock layers display a variety of colors under the light. After the visit, head to Burqin county town for overnight stay, where you can stroll along the riverside night market and sample local specialty food.
Day 2: Depart from Burqin to Jiadengyu ticket station. After completing entry procedures, take the scenic area shuttle bus into Kanas Scenic Area. First visit Wolong Bay, Moon Bay, and Xian Bay in sequence — these three spots are connected by walking trails, so you can hike a section for a closer view of the lake. Then explore the walking trails along the Kanas Lake shore. In the evening, return to Jiadengyu or your accommodation inside the scenic area to rest.
Day 3:After breakfast, depart from Kanas to Baihaba Village. Visit the village’s viewing platforms and valley walking trails. After lunch, wander freely through the village. In the afternoon, depending on the time, either return to Kanas or head directly to the Hemu ticket station, complete entry procedures, and take the shuttle bus into Hemu Village for overnight stay.
Day 4:Spend the full day exploring Hemu Village. Get up early to watch the morning mist from the viewing platform, then stroll across Hemu Bridge and along the village trails. You can also choose to experience the officially operated horse riding and hiking activities in the scenic area. In the evening, enjoy the village cooking smoke and sunset views. Overnight in Hemu Village.
Day 5:After breakfast, depart from Hemu and drive back along the mountain roads to Burqin, then continue to Urho. You can stop at a Gobi desert viewing platform for photos along the way. Upon arriving in Urho, visit the World Devil City to see the Yadan landform landscape. Overnight in Urho city.

🍃 Practical travel tips
1. Tickets: Kanas peak-season ticket reference price is 160 RMB/person, shuttle bus 110 RMB/person; Hemu peak-season ticket reference price is 60 RMB/person, shuttle bus 50 RMB/person. Eligible groups can enjoy corresponding ticket discounts, subject to the scenic area’s official announcements on the day. You can also entrust the travel agency to help book tickets in advance to save queue time at the venue.
2. Packing: The temperature difference between day and night in the scenic area can reach 10-15 degrees Celsius in summer. Even when traveling in July, bring a moderately thick windproof jacket, plus high-SPF sunscreen, a sun hat, an umbrella or raincoat, and common medications such as digestive medicine and cold medicine.
3. Visiting notes: Kanas Scenic Area contains a high-quality nature reserve. It is strictly forbidden to bring fire sources or smoke anywhere in the area. Pets are not allowed inside. Do not enter undeveloped or unopened areas, do not camp without authorization, and do not touch or feed wild animals.
4. Road conditions: In summer, brief rainfall and fog may occur in the mountain areas. The veteran driver will adjust driving speed and stopping points based on real-time road conditions. In cases of temporary traffic controls or scenic area crowd management measures, both parties can negotiate itinerary adjustments to ensure a good visiting experience.
